Protein power: could your diet be the key to better sleep?
Symptom relief OngoingThis study looks at whether eating more protein—from either animal or plant sources—can improve sleep quality in older adults in Singapore. Standing desks and moving lessons: a school experiment to boost kids' brains and bodies
Knowledge-focused OngoingThis study tests a new way of teaching called MOVI-OLE! that uses special furniture and active lessons to get kids moving more in class.
